This is a gem of a place! Started off with clams in a delicious lemon garlic broth. Clams were pretty small, but the broth really made up for it. For pasta we got the bison ravioli and the pancetta rigatoni. The bison was super tender and the red sauce was great. But the star of the night was the pancetta rigatoni with the most delicious creamy vodka sauce. It had a smoky flavor to it and the pancetta was cut perfectly. You could literally drink the sauce it was so good! Our waiter Luca was also super friendly and honestly made the whole experience great. Before we left, he gave us homemade Limoncello shots, some of the best limoncello I’ve ever had. I know people have complained of service being slow, but it truly is worth the wait. This place is a labor of love.
